High Hopes:
The song is about never giving up and fighting through all the obstacles, having... you guessed it, high hopes, to get through the struggles of him and his "band".
The video symbolizes his journey through his stardom. At first with people bumping into him not caring it symbolizes before he was famous. Once he starts climbing the building more and more people gather around taking videos and watching him. This symbolizes when they kicked off more and more people gathering around meaning more and more fans. When he stumbles and almost falls that symbolizes when Ryan and Jon left it being hard for him but he kept through it. One he arrives at the top that symbolizes him making it big. With the member on the rooftop (his live band) symbolizes where he is now.

Actually, The Ballad of Mona Lisa's meaning has nothing to do with the video. The song is about the ethical aspects of prostitution. The RUclips channel "The Pop Song Professor" has a very good explanation of the song.
Also, "Death of a Bachelor" is about him getting married. The title is a more metaphoric version of the words "getting married".
